Pulsed laser deposition (PLD) is a physical vapor deposition (PVD) technique where a high-power pulsed laser beam is focused inside a vacuum chamber to strike a target of the material that is to be deposited. W lipcu 2021 roku firma GMV dostarczyła do PLD pierwszy kompletny system awioniki, w pełni zintegrowany z komorą ...UHV-PLD systems integrated with Reflection High-Energy Electron Diffraction (RHEED) diagnostics are also known as Laser MBE systems. These systems are used for creating high-quality epitaxial films and novel interfaces with exceptional film growth-control at the atomic level as has been done conventionally in Molecular Beam Epitaxy (MBE) Systems. A high magnetic field assisted pulsed laser deposition (HMF-PLD) system has been developed to in situ grow thin films in a high magnetic field up to 10 T. In this system, a specially designed PLD cylindrical vacuum chamber is horizontally located in the bore configuration of a superconducting magnet with a bore diameter of 200 mm.Pulsed Laser Deposition. SERVICE TSST PLD systems are installed and acceptance tested on site by experiencedA simplified PAL device. The programmable elements (shown as a fuse) connect both the true and complemented inputs to the AND gates. These AND gates, also known as product terms, are ORed together to form a sum-of-products logic array. A programmable logic device ( PLD) is an electronic component used to build reconfigurable digital circuits. .
